Job description

Summary/Position Objectives

This position is responsible for oversight of the planning, development, implementation, and evaluation of Care Management (CM) programs. The Manager of CM is responsible for ensuring staff follow the care management process as defined by improving coordination, continuity, accessibility, and appropriate utilization of healthcare services and community resources for high-risk and special needs members, improving health outcomes and engagement in health seeking behaviors.

About Maryland Care Management, Inc. (MCMI)

Maryland Care Management, Inc. (MCMI) manages Maryland Physician Care's (MPC) statewide provider network of hospitals and physicians. Maryland Physicians Care has been providing services to the HealthChoice Medicaid populations since 1996, and we are proud of our footprint in the community. With over 230,000 members, MPC consistently has been one of MD's largest Medicaid-managed care organizations.

What You'll Do


  • Provide oversight of care management programs.

  • Responsible for recruitment and selection of appropriate staff and prepares for timely employee performance evaluations.

  • Promote individual and team development and provide performance management, when necessary.

  • Prepare reports on key indicators and activities for committees and senior management.

  • Collaborate with the Director of CM on development of annual budget and operates within approved budget.

  • Collaborate with interdisciplinary teams to support staff in coordination of care activities.

  • Serves as a resource for health plan information and helps to integrate care management functions throughout the health plan.

  • Assists in the annual development of measurable goals for care management programs based on data from outcomes reports, quality indicators, regulatory agencies, and health plan initiatives and priorities.

  • Implement ongoing development and education of care management staff.

  • Ensures that program integrity and regulatory requirements are met in conjunction with the Director of CM.

  • Other duties as assigned.


Secondary Functions


  • Communicates regularly with employees through staff meetings to share company, health plan, and department information appropriate to their job function.

  • Maintains and promotes patient confidentiality and adheres to HIPAA regulations.

  • Responsible for development, implementation, and annual review of care management policies and desktops.


Requirements

Knowledge and Skills:



  • Demonstrated skills for presentations and training before small and large groups.

  • Knowledge of local health care delivery system.

  • Strong problem solving, organizational, and time management skills with the ability to work in a fast-paced environment.

  • The ability to successfully utilize Microsoft Office suite and common computer and office hardware is necessary.


Education And Work Experience


  • Current state RN license required.

  • Bachelor of Science in Nursing (BSN) preferred.

  • Minimum of two years of management/supervisory experience required.

  • Minimum of three years of care management experience required.

  • CCM Certification preferred.

  • Managed Care experience is preferred.
